    We stumbled upon this taco shop when we were out shopping in the area this weekend. We were so pleased to see that it reminded us of a very popular chain we frequented in Los Angeles. The menu was identical and the food was reminiscent of what we had missed when we moved here. Plenty of options of choice of meats for tacos, tostada, torta, sopes, rolled tacos (taquitos). We were overly excited because we ordered too much food and both my husband and I were overly full. The barbacoa and carnitas are a standout, but I'm sure all of their meats are delicious. They have combo plates which we didn't get so I can't speak to their rice or beans. I will say that the guacamole wasn't very flavorful. They give you lime wedges with the tacos, so we used that to jazz up the guacamole. The restaurant is unassuming and welcoming. The staff was friendly. It was nice to hear Spanish speakers. I will say that I had to deduct a star because their air conditioning was not working. With 108 degree weather, it was no bueno.

    Having lived in San Diego, this place reminds of a local taco shop in California. The flavors are more akin to the Mexican food you would find there. There is less cheese associated with the Tex Mex (which I love too) here in Texas. I got the Picadillo and Fajitas tacos. The tacos were small but comparable to street tacos in size at other places. This place is not as fancy as Torchy's or Rusty's Tacos. The quality is better than a fast food chain like Taco Cabaña or Taco Bueno. Will come back again.

    This place is literally 0.3 miles from the condo, my husband has already been here a few times for breakfast tacos. I sent him for a pick up dinner. It is difficult to figure out what to order since you need to look at the blurry menu photos on Yelp - there is no website and no menu posted on Yelp. (My husband did ask for a paper menu that I was going to photo clearly and post, but they said they did not have any.) I ordered the #1 (might as well start at the top right?) a beef taco and a cheese enchilada. We also ordered a carnitas sope to split. The sope was my favorite, and would be perfect for a light (small qty, not diet) dinner. I really enjoyed the tacos, they obviously fry the corn tortillas in house. My lease favorite was the cheese enchilada, those really need to be eaten directly after assembly, the one was a bit cold and no cheesy stringy-ness.
